At their core, brake calipers function via hydraulic pressure. When you press the brake pedal, fluid is forced from the master cylinder, pushing pistons within the caliper. These pistons then squeeze the brake pads onto the spinning brake rotor. This friction converts kinetic energy into heat, slowing the wheel. The effectiveness of this process hinges on the caliper's rigidity, the precision of its internal components, and the quality of its seals. For Nugeon, this means focusing on materials and manufacturing tolerances that can withstand repeated, high-stress engagements without warping or binding.

Key Components and Their Roles

A Nugeon brake caliper assembly typically includes the caliper body, pistons, seals, and bleed screws. The caliper body, often cast from iron or aluminum, houses the pistons and provides mounting points. Pistons, usually made of steel or aluminum, are forced outwards by hydraulic pressure. High-performance Nugeon calipers might feature larger or multiple pistons to distribute force more evenly and increase clamping power, a common upgrade for vehicles like performance sedans or sports cars. Seals prevent brake fluid leaks and contamination, crucial for maintaining consistent hydraulic pressure. The bleed screw allows air to be purged from the hydraulic system, ensuring optimal brake feel.

Heat Management and Durability

Braking generates substantial heat, and poorly designed calipers can suffer from thermal expansion, leading to reduced effectiveness or caliper drag. High-quality Nugeon brake calipers, especially those constructed from aluminum alloys, offer superior heat dissipation compared to standard cast iron. This characteristic is vital for preventing brake fade during prolonged braking events, such as descending long grades or during spirited driving on a track. Robust seals and piston materials also play a role in maintaining performance under high temperatures.

Installation Best Practices

Proper installation is non-negotiable for the safety and performance of Nugeon brake calipers. While many are designed as direct bolt-on replacements, certain performance upgrades might necessitate additional modifications. It is imperative to follow manufacturer-specific torque specifications for all mounting hardware to prevent component failure or loosening. Bleeding the brake system thoroughly after installation is critical to remove any air, ensuring a firm pedal feel and consistent hydraulic pressure. If you are not experienced with brake systems, engaging a qualified mechanic is highly recommended, especially for complex setups or when working with high-performance components that might mimic solutions found on models like the CTS-V brake calipers.

Always use new brake hardware, including banjo bolts and crush washers, when installing new calipers to ensure a leak-free seal and proper connection.

Routine Maintenance and Longevity

To maximize the lifespan and performance of Nugeon brake calipers, regular maintenance is key. This includes periodic inspection of caliper seals for any signs of cracking, drying, or leaks, which could lead to contamination or fluid loss. Checking brake fluid levels and condition, and flushing the system according to recommended intervals, prevents corrosion and maintains hydraulic efficiency.
